Escallonia 'Iveyi' is an upright, evergreen shrub with small, dark green, glossy leaves. Pretty pure white trumpet shaped fragrant flowers contrasts well with the dark foliage. Excellent as a heging plant and thrives in all well drained soils. Fragrant flowers June to September, loved by pollinating insects. Can be used as an alternative to box hedging or grown as an attractive shrub in its own right. Will grow to 3 metres if left untrimmed. Grows happily in coastal gardens.
- Position: Full sun/part shade
- Soil: Well drained, fertile soil
- Eventual Size: 3m
- Habit: Upright, bushy
- Foliage: Dark green, glossy leaves
- Flower: White flowers in Summer
- Flowering period: June to September
- Hardiness: Hardy through most of the UK (-10 to -5) Hardy through most of the UK (-10 to -5)
- Rate of growth: Average
- Common Names: Escallonia Iveyi


Escallonia 'Iveyi' Care
Prune back flowering shoots in autumn
